Ford Sells Irvine, CA Office Complex

Jun 2, 2009 - CRE News

Ford Motor Co. has sold a 270,000-square-foot office complex in Irvine, Calif., for $73 million. Transpacific Development Co. of Torrance, Calif., bought the two-building complex, at 1 Premier Place, in a deal brokered by CB Richard Ellis. The automotive company will continue to lease some space in the property. Taco Bell Corp. will relocate its headquarters into 180,000 sf of the complex next year under a 10-year lease that Ford negotiated before selling the property.
